Studley pub destroyed in blaze
FIRE crews were called out to The Griffin public house in Studley at 5.35am on Sunday, May 5, when a fire tore through the building.
The derelict pub, on Green Lane in Studley, is currently under refurbishment and lying empty.
The fire is believed to have caused significant damage to the basement of the building as well as the ground floor and first floor.
Four fire crews responded to the blaze, three from the Redditch fire station and one from Bromsgrove. They were on the site tackling the blaze until 8.15am, when crews from Warwickshire took over in damping down the building.
The cause of the fire is as yet unknown and the incident is under investigation by Warwickshire Fire and Rescue.
